Problems solved by technology

The reason is that the directions of the defects distributed on the surface of the steel plate are various, while conventional eddy current probes are very sensitive to the orientation of defects and the direction of scanning defects, it is difficult for an eddy current probe to detect defects in various directions

Abstract

The invention belongs to the technical field of flaw detection of steel plates and particularly relates to an eddy current probe for detecting multi-direction defects on a thin steel plate surface. The eddy current probe (17) comprises a first detecting unit (1) and a second detecting unit (2), which are vertical to each other, wherein each detecting unit comprises excitation coils and receiving coils, which wind in a mutual vertical manner; the excitation coils of the detecting units of the probe are serially connected, a differential receiving coil formed by the receiving coils of the first detecting unit (1) is serially connected with a differential receiving coil formed by the receiving coils of the second detecting unit (2); the probe is fixedly placed and is connected to a single-channel eddy current flaw detector. The eddy current probe provided by the invention is composed of multiple groups of excitation coils and multiple groups of receiving coils, and one eddy current flaw detector channel is used for detecting the defects in various directions of the steel plate surface. Meanwhile, since the probe is fixedly placed, the requirements on the mechanical structure of online flaw detection equipment are greatly simplified, and the equipment cost is reduced.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ention belongs to the technical field of steel plate flaw detection, and in particular relates to an eddy current probe used for detecting multi-directional defects on the surface of thin steel plates. Background technique [0002] With the rapid development of my country's manufacturing industry, the demand for high-end thin sheets is increasing. Taking the high-grade automobile sheets that mainly relied on imports in the past as an example, most of them are now producing and manufacturing by themselves. Simultaneously with this, new requirements are put forward for the quality inspection of steel plates. [0003] At present, the surface detection of domestic automobile steel plates is generally carried out by CCD image monitoring method, but this method is easy to miss detection because it needs to rely on human eye observation.
